The Matterhorn watches over every run, and no cars are allowed to spoil the view. Zermatt skis all year on the Theodul glacier, the only resort in the Alps that genuinely never closes.

Statistically the snowiest corner of the Alps, and the most discreet. Lech and Zürs sit just above St. Anton but trade its rowdy bars for quiet luxury and the elegant White Ring circuit.

Off-piste in every direction, a World Cup pedigree, and 300 km of pistes shared with Tignes across the Espace Killy. Val d'Isère earns its reputation on the steep faces of Solaise and in the wild bowl of Le Fornet.

Alpine tourism was born here in 1864, and the place has never let you forget it. Two Olympics, the Cresta Run, polo and horse racing on a frozen lake: St. Moritz wraps serious skiing in old-money theatre.

Freeriders make the pilgrimage here for the Xtreme and the merciless Tortin couloir. Verbier sits at the top of the 4 Vallées, Switzerland's largest domain, and the nightlife matches the terrain for sheer intensity.

More Michelin stars than any ski village on earth, and a western doorway into Les 3 Vallées. Courchevel stacks six villages by altitude, from the palace hotels of 1850 down to the family runs of Le Praz.

Once the favourite of the Habsburg court, Madonna di Campiglio still carries that imperial polish. The pearl of the Brenta Dolomites draws crowds each December for the 3Tre, a World Cup slalom run under floodlights.

When the Spanish royal family goes skiing, this is where they come. Baqueira Beret is the largest resort in Spain, with three connected sectors and the Michelin-starred tables of the Aran Valley waiting at the bottom.

A Graubünden village at 1,200 m, sister to Davos under a single lift pass and 300 km of piste, where King Charles takes his winters and the Gotschnabahn leaves from the railway platform.

They call her the queen of the Dolomites, and the UNESCO peaks of the Tofane and Cinque Torri explain why. Cortina co-hosts the 2026 Winter Olympics, but its real currency is the long, sunlit lunch on a mountain terrace.

Corvara sits at the heart of Alta Badia at 1,568 m, with the Sella massif rising straight above the village and the Sellaronda circuit starting at the door. Ladin-speaking, beautifully kept, with Michelin-starred kitchens scattered through the valley. The 130 km of local piste open onto Dolomiti Superski's 1,200 km network.

Few resorts get this much sun. Crans-Montana spreads across a south-facing plateau above the Rhône valley, hosts the Omega European Masters golf in summer, and keeps a relaxed, wellness-minded pace on the snow.
